Cranberry-Orange Sauce

Ingredients:

  • 2 large oranges
  • 1 cup fresh cranberries
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• ΒΌ teaspoon ground cinnamon

Instructions:

  1. Juice the Oranges: Begin by squeezing the juice from the oranges. You should aim for about 1 cup of fresh orange juice. If you don’t quite reach 1 cup, make up the difference with a bit of water to ensure the sauce has the right consistency.

  2. Combine Ingredients: In a 2-quart saucepan, combine the fresh cranberry juice, cranberries, granulated sugar, and ground cinnamon. Stir well to ensure the sugar is evenly distributed.

  3. Cook the Sauce: Place the saucepan over medium heat and bring the mixture to a rolling boil. Once boiling, reduce the heat to a simmer. Allow the sauce to cook for approximately 5 to 8 minutes, stirring occasionally. You’ll know it’s ready when the cranberries have popped and the mixture has thickened to your desired consistency.

  4. Cool and Chill: As the sauce cools, it will continue to thicken. For the best results, refrigerate it for at least 3 hours. If you prefer, you can prepare this sauce a day in advance. It will keep well in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.

Notes:

  • Consistency: The sauce thickens as it cools, so don’t be concerned if it seems a bit thin while it’s still warm.
  • Make Ahead: This sauce is perfect for preparing in advance, making your holiday preparations just a bit easier.
  • Storage: Store the cooled sauce in an airtight container in the refrigerator. It’s great to have on hand for up to 4 days.
